DeNiro cold called his longtime collaborator and friend Martin Scorsese just to wish him sweet dreams, much to the director's confusion and amusement. The phone exchange, which was captured on video to promote the duo's appearances at the Tribeca Film Festival, is part of a broader TikTok trend. Known colloquially as the "goodnight" trend, the viral movement sees men surprise their friends by wishing them a good night in an out-of-the-blue phone call — a gesture uncommon in its casual intimacy among male friends.
In the video, Scorsese accepts a call from the Taxi Driver star. "Hello? Bob?" he asks.
"I'm calling to say good night!" the actor says. "And sleep tight."
Scorsese appears a little confused but maintains polite composure. "Okay, thank you," he responds.
De Niro then asks his friend to switch the call to FaceTime. Scorsese accepts, and asks the actor what he's up to.
"Here's what I'm doing, I'm watching this," De Niro says, turning his phone camera around to reveal The Wiggles playing on TV. (For more on De Niro's Wiggles obsession, read EW's interview with the band here.)
"Oh, great, that's really good," Scorsese says upon seeing the Wiggles.
"I'll see you. Seeya tomorrow," De Niro says. "Sleep well, dear."
Scorsese plays along. "Okay, thank you, my love," he says, laughing. "Bye!"
